轉行進入IT行業,0基礎學習大資料開發必備的基礎有哪些?

資料工程師陳晨發表於2019-04-21

IT行業發展速度快,市場需求大,而且,程式設計師薪酬高、福利待遇高,成為很多從業者嚮往的職業,當然,也刺激了很多非計算機專業的從業者進入該領域。轉行進入IT行業在最近的幾年一直是個熱門,那麼對於0基礎的求學者,入行大資料開發需要什麼基礎呢?

推薦下我自己建的大資料學習交流群:740041381,群裡都是學大資料開發的,如果你正在學習大資料 ,小編歡迎你加入,大家都是軟體開發黨,不定期分享乾貨(只有大資料軟體開發相關的),包括我自己整理的一份最新的大資料進階資料和高階開發教程,歡迎進階中和進想深入大資料的小夥伴加入。

 

在很多人眼中大資料都是一個高階的行業,而且,一聯想到IT、資料,很多人就開始糾結,學習大資料開發是否需要數學、英語等基礎呢?是不是0基礎就無法真正的學懂大資料開發呢?

首先:數學、英語不是限制,邏輯思維是關鍵

學程式開發,入行IT領域要有一定的邏輯思維能力,而邏輯思維能力並不是天生的,可以通過鍛鍊得到提升。在學習程式設計過程中,我們不必等到什麼都完全明白了才去動手實踐,只要明白了大概,就要敢於自己動手去體驗。誰都有第一次。有些問題只有通過實踐後才能明白,也只有實踐才能把老師和書上的知識變成自己的,高手都是這樣成材的。

另外值得注意是,學習一門語言或開發工具,語法結構、功能呼叫是次要的,最主要是學習它的思想。例如學習 VC就要學習 Windows的內在機理、什麼是執行緒......;學習 COM就要知道 VTALBE、類廠、介面、idl......,關鍵是學一種思想,有了思想,那麼我們就可以觸類旁通。

其次:努力是最主要的基礎

學習一門IT技術,最主要的基礎就是自己的努力。畢竟,在學習的過程中,程式設計會人很多人感到枯燥、感到不耐煩,而且,在敲程式的時候,往往一個符號的錯誤就會讓整個程式癱瘓,而你,有足夠的耐心,足夠的努力去堅持嗎?

下面,我們可以詳細的瞭解一下,0基礎學習大資料開發該如何學習?如何才能夠快速的完成轉型?

目前,很多具備程式設計經驗的從業者已經通過自學進入到了大資料領域。對於0基礎的人來講,自學是有一定難度的,沒有人引導,容易卡在某一個問題上,長久得不到進展,或者進展緩慢,最可能的結果就是從入門到放棄。0基礎學程式設計還是需要老師的引導,才可以快速上道。因此,很多0基礎的求學者都選擇通過參加大資料培訓班來學習。畢竟,這種學習方式的優勢還是很多的。

第一:系統化課程+經驗豐富講師

0基礎學大資料開發一定要系統化的學習,畢竟沒有基礎。如果沒有一個系統化的課程,既不利於學習的高效性,也不利於形成完整的知識體系。另外,大資料包含的內容很多,0基礎的求學者如果沒有專門的老師帶著去學習,在學習的過程會遇到很多的瓶頸,從而降低學習的效率。

第二:測驗+實訓專案,保障學習效率

在學習的過程中,不僅是需要努力去向前學習,更需要不斷的去複習。但是,很多求學者在複習的時候卻往往找不到方向,而這,就需要定時的測驗來幫助求學者去檢驗自己學習效果,當然,也能夠為求學者提供複習的方向。

對於實訓專案的操作,並不只是讓求學者提高實戰能力,還是讓求學者能夠在真實的實訓專案當中,找到自己的欠缺,以便自己及時的去複習,及時的去完善和提升自己。

進入大資料領域,被很多人看成是實現自己快速發展的一個契機,但是,誰都不可能一下吃成個胖子。學習必須腳踏實地的來。而你準備好入行大資料了嗎?

 

相關文章